I headed out of Fort Nelson and continued south. When I first started it was cold and raining fairly hard but the weather improved as the day went on. There didn't seem to be a lot of interest along this stretch of the ALCAN.
I eventually reached Dawson Creek, BC, the Mile 0 point of the ALCAN. It was still early enough that I wanted to do some more driving but towns are few and far between up here so I couldn't just drive until I was tired and expect to find a place to stay. It was still early when I reached Grande Prairie but I'm not aware of any significant cities between here and Edmonton, the next major city I'll hit, so I decided to stay there for the night.
I still have 27 hours 8 minutes and 1,720 miles to go to reach Telluride. In other words, after four days of driving I'm not quite half way there.
